How To Override A WooCommerce AJAX Function

Ok, so I don’t know if this is the best way, but it’s working for now.

Within my OOP class (I have a custom plugin to override a WC plugin):

    remove_action( 'wp_ajax_wc_function', array( WC_Parent_Class, 'wc_do_stuff' ) );
    remove_action( 'wp_ajax_nopriv_wc_function', array( WC_Parent_Class, 'wc_do_stuff' ) );
    add_action( 'wp_ajax_wc_function', array( __CLASS__, 'my_override_do_stuff' ) );
    add_action( 'wp_ajax_nopriv_wc_function', array( __CLASS__, 'my_override_do_stuff' ) 

Hope this helps someone and I’d welcome/appreciate if anyone has a better method. 🙂